The saponin fraction from the fresh leaves of Euptelea polyandra SIEB. et ZUCC. was found to exhibit potent gastroprotective activity. Fourteen new nortriterpene saponins called eupteleasaponins were isolated from the saponin fraction with gastroprotective activity. The structures of eupteleasaponins I, II, III, IV, V, and V acetate were determined on the basis of chemical and physicochemical evidence as 3-O-α-L-rhamnopyranosyl(1→2)-β-D-glucopyranosyl(1→3)-β-D-xylopyranosylakebonoic acid 28-O-β-D-glucopyranosyl ester, 3-O-α-L-rhamnopyranosyl(1→2)-[α-L-rhamnopyranosyl(1→4)]-β-D-glucopyranosyl(1→3)-β-D-xylopyranosylakebonoic acid 28-O-β-D-glucopyranosyl ester, 3-O-α-L-rhamnopyranosyl(1→2)-[α-L-arabinopyranosyl(1→4)-α-L-rhamnopyranosyl(1→4)]-β-D-glucopyranosyl(1→3)-β-D-xylopyranosylakebonoic acid 28-O-β-D-glucopyranosyl ester, 3-O-α-L-rhamnopyranosyl(1→2)-[α-L-arabinopyranosyl(1→4)-α-L-rhamnopyranosyl(1→4)]-β-D-glucopyranosyl(1→3)-β-D-xylopyranosylakebonoic acid, 3-O-α-L-rhamnopyranosyl(1→2)-β-D-glucopyranosyl(1→3)-β-D-xylopyranosyleupteleogenin, and 3-O-α-L-rhamnopyranosyl(1→2)-6"-O-acetyl-β-D-glucopyranosyl(1→3)-β-D-xylopyranosyleupteleogenin
